A commemorative sports memorabilia plaque honoring Cal Ripken Jr. and his record-breaking 2,131st consecutive game played. The assembly is mounted on a rectangular wood-grain finished base. The upper portion features a color photograph of Ripken at bat at Camden Yards in Baltimore, Maryland, with the record-setting number 2131 displayed on the stadium scoreboard. Below the photograph is an engraved brass-toned plate with black text documenting the event on September 6, 1995, against the California Angels. To the right of the plate is a 1982 Topps Baltimore Orioles Future Stars rookie card featuring Cal Ripken Jr., Bob Bonner, and Jeff Schneider. The card is housed in a protective plastic case and identified by a small metal plate inscribed ROOKIE CARD.
Condition: The plaque is in good overall condition with minor shelf wear consistent with age and handling. All components, including the photograph, card, and metal plates, appear securely mounted.
